Geert Verheyden: Belgium’s Vision for Better Stroke Care Across the Continuum
Geert Verheyden, Professor and Stroke Rehabilitation Research Lead at KU Leuven, shared on LinkedIn:
”Belgian Stroke Care Meeting
Interesting meeting set up yesterday by the Belgian Stroke Council (BSC) to further shape the Belgian Stroke Care Plan.
Strong message:
‘Hyperacute stroke care is only one part of the story,a large part of outcome is determined before hospital arrival, a large part of outcome is determined after hospital discharge’
Great session on life after stroke, moderated by people with lived experience.”
